In This print, a young girl named Juanita stands with her back to the viewer, completely absorbed in the act of creation. She wears a striped shirt and dark denim, her hands reaching up to add to a sprawling mural of line drawings that cover the crumbling plaster. The composition is balanced by a wooden stepladder to the right, creating a sense of height and industry within the home environment.
Captured in the early 1950s, this image radiates the unselfconscious joy of childhood exploration. It reflects the photographer’s mastery of light and shadow, using the neutral tones of the wall to highlight the dark silhouettes of the child and the ladder. There is a profound sense of stillness here, suggesting a private world where imagination knows no bounds and every inch of space is a potential canvas for a child’s story.
